In the 1990s, class-action lawsuits were commonplace, however they are not as common today. Instead, it's more common to pursue an individual injury or wrongful death lawsuit or to file for mesothelioma compensation through an asbestos trust fund for bankruptcy.

Asbestos victims who have been in the military might be eligible for additional forms of mesothelioma compensation. These benefits include veterans' pensions as well as disability benefits, which could assist in covering a variety of medical and financial expenses. Trusts for asbestos are set up by companies that once produced or used, or even sold asbestos-containing materials. These companies have since gone under however, trusts that are still in existence have funds that could be awarded to victims.

The most popular types of mesothelioma lawsuits are personal injury claims and wrongful death claims. The surviving family members are able to file a mesothelioma suit in the event that the estate hasn't yet received compensation.

Wrongful death lawsuits are brought by the heirs of an asbestos exposed victim who died of mesothelioma. These lawsuits are intended to make asbestos companies accountable for their wrongful actions that caused a victim's illness.

Pain and Suffering

Mesothelioma lawyers can aid you get compensation for your emotional and physical suffering. Pain and suffering is the term used for the discomfort, inconvenience anxiety, stress, and anxiety a victim feels due to their injury. Physical pain and suffering is related to the impact of the injury on the life of a victim. For instance, if mesothelioma symptoms cause them to have difficulties walking or commuting for longer. Mental suffering and pain could include anger, depression and loss of appetite.

Mesothelioma is an uncommon, but deadly form of cancer that affects the tissues that line the body's organs and structures. It is most often found in the pleura (tissue that surrounds the lung) but it can also be found in the tissue surrounding the stomach, heart and testicles.
